我在超级用户上有一个related question。我的笔记本电脑上的默认网关IP地址不断变化,似乎没有办法阻止它。是否有一个Windows API(或等效的),我可以用来监听IP地址更改事件,并找出启动更改的程序或计算机?
答案 0 :(得分:0)
没有用于监控IP更改的API,更不用说API来告诉您启动更改的内容。但是,如果您只想检测网关IP何时更改,您可以定期调用GetAdaptersInfo()
或GetAdaptersAddresses()
,例如在计时器中,找到您感兴趣的适配器,并跟踪其当前网关值,以便您可以随时间进行比较。